Key Technologies Behind Interactive Websites

The foundation of interactive websites that empower users to contribute and modify content is built on a diverse array of advanced technologies. By leveraging these tools, businesses can create a dynamic online environment that not only enhances user engagement but also improves overall website functionality. Whether you’re running a blog, a community forum, or an e-commerce site, understanding the key technologies at your disposal is crucial to cultivating a vibrant user-generated content ecosystem.

One essential technology is content management systems (CMS), such as WordPress, Drupal, or Joomla. These platforms allow users to create, edit, and organize content with ease. With built-in plugins like BuddyPress for creating social networks or bbPress for discussion forums, a CMS can become a powerful engine for community interaction. Implementing a robust CMS enables you to maintain control over content while simultaneously encouraging user contributions, leading to an enriched resource that reflects a wide range of perspectives.

Another vital component is JavaScript frameworks such as React, Vue.js, and Angular. These tools provide the interactivity users crave by allowing real-time updates without necessitating a page refresh. For example, using AJAX (Asynchronous JavaScript and XML) enables content retrieval and submission asynchronously, which boosts the overall user experience. By incorporating interactive elements like live editing features or voting systems, visitors can engage more deeply with the content, resulting in longer session durations and higher retention rates.

Furthermore, utilizing cloud-based technologies and APIs allows for dynamic interactions and integrations with third-party services. By connecting your website to social media platforms or content donation systems, you can expand your reach and enhance user interaction. Integration with analytics tools such as Google Analytics or Mixpanel is key for tracking user engagement metrics, helping you to adapt strategies based on real-time data, ultimately driving better outcomes.

In summary, the key technologies that power interactive websites extend beyond basic functionality to include sophisticated content management systems, JavaScript frameworks, and integration with external services. By thoughtfully implementing these tools, you can empower your users to take control of their digital experience, consequently enhancing user engagement, loyalty, and the overall success of your platform. leveraging these technologies strategically will position your website as a thriving hub for community and connection.

Measuring User Engagement: Metrics That Matter

Measuring user engagement effectively is crucial in determining how well your interactive website is performing and identifying areas for improvement. Understanding metrics that matter allows you to gauge the effectiveness of your user-generated content features, which are pivotal in transforming passive visitors into active participants. Consider this: websites that utilize compelling engagement strategies often report an increase in user retention by as much as 50%. This statistic underscores the importance of focusing on relevant metrics that not only track user behavior but also translate into actionable insights for your ongoing strategy.

To start, focus on key metrics that directly reflect user interactions with your site. These include:

  • Active Users: Track daily and monthly active users to understand how many unique visitors are engaging with your content over time. A rising trend can indicate effective engagement strategies.
  • Time on Page: Monitor the average duration users spend on pages that feature user-generated content. Longer times typically signify well-received interactive elements.
  • Page Views Per Session: A higher number indicates that users are finding value and are motivated to explore more of your site.
  • Engagement Rate: Calculate this by dividing total interactions (comments, shares, likes) by the total number of users. This gives you a clear picture of how engaging your content truly is.
  • Conversion Rates: For many businesses, the ultimate goal is conversion. Whether it’s filling out a form, subscribing to a newsletter, or making a purchase, understanding how user engagement impacts these figures is critical.

By effectively analyzing these metrics, you can fine-tune your approach to user engagement. For example, if you discover that users are spending significant time on a specific feature, you might consider expanding it or integrating similar functionalities elsewhere. On the other hand, if engagement rates are dipping, you can immediately investigate which elements of the interactive experience may not be resonating with your audience.

User Experience and Accessibility Considerations

Creating an interactive website where users can make changes is a powerful strategy for unleashing user engagement. However, if users feel overwhelmed or excluded due to design flaws or accessibility barriers, your initiative can fail to achieve its desired impact. Approximately 15% of the global population experiences some form of disability, emphasizing the importance of accessibility in your online presence. Integrating user experience (UX) with accessibility considerations not only makes your site welcoming but also enhances overall engagement and satisfaction.

To ensure your website is accessible, begin by implementing key design principles that prioritize usability for all users, irrespective of their physical abilities or technological access. For instance, using color contrast ratios that meet W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) standards helps visually impaired users navigate content without straining their eyes. Additionally, providing alternative text for images allows screen reader users to understand visual content, transforming passive engagement into an interactive experience.

Moreover, incorporating keyboard navigation and ensuring that interactive elements are accessible via tab orders can significantly elevate user interaction. Users with mobility impairments may rely on keyboards rather than mouse devices, so you should test your site’s functionality extensively to uncover any potential hindrances. Utilizing tools such as WAVE or axe can provide comprehensive reports of accessibility issues, guiding systematic improvements.

Overcoming Common Challenges in User Interaction

Engaging users in a way that allows them to shape their experience can be rewarding, but it also presents various challenges that require thoughtful navigation. One of the primary hurdles is ensuring that user-generated changes do not compromise the website’s integrity. This concern can be mitigated by implementing robust moderation systems. For example, creating a submission process where user changes are reviewed before going live helps maintain quality control while fostering a sense of community ownership. Establishing clear guidelines for user contributions can also preempt confusion and miscommunication.

Another significant challenge lies in the technical execution of interactive features. Websites must be designed to accommodate user changes seamlessly. If technical glitches arise, user frustration will likely result, deterring future engagement. To counter this, invest in thorough testing before launching these interactive features. Regular updates and maintenance checks are essential to ensure compatibility with various devices and browsers, providing a smooth user experience.

User education is also a crucial component of enhancing interaction on your website. Users may not fully understand how to utilize the features you provide, leading to underutilization. Offering tutorials, FAQs, or engaging videos demonstrating how they can participate will empower users and encourage exploration. For instance, a simple onboarding tutorial can show users how to customize their profiles or navigate new features effectively, boosting confidence and interaction rates.

Finally, one of the more overlooked aspects of user interaction is managing differing engagement levels within the community. Some users may be highly active while others are more passive. To address this, consider implementing tiered rewards systems that recognize varying levels of participation. This strategy not only incentivizes users to engage more but also levels the playing field, encouraging less active users to contribute without feeling overwhelmed. Utilizing gamification elements like badges or levels can further motivate users to interact with the platform, fostering a more engaged community overall.
